Inspection on 2/25/2025
High Priority
4
Intermediate
1
Basic
4
Total
9
Disposition: Facility Temporarily Closed
Inspection Details:
- 22-20-5:Basic - Accumulation of black/green mold-like substance in the interior of the ice machine/bin. Observed black build up on their ice machine. **Warning**
- 14-09-4:Basic - Cutting board has cut marks and is no longer cleanable. Observed their cutting boards with grooves. **Warning**
- 40-06-5:Basic - Employee personal items stored in or above a food preparation area, food, clean equipment and utensils, or single-service items. Observed numerous employee items stored above and on clean dishes and boxes of single service items. Operator removed them. **Corrected On-Site** **Warning**
- 36-17-5:Basic - Floor tiles missing and/or in disrepair. Observed them missing floor tiles at the triple sink. **Warning**
- 14-31-5:High Priority - Nonfood-grade bags used in direct contact with food. Observed nonfood-grade bags in direct contact with food product in their reach and walk in coolers. Operator placed them in food grade bags. **Corrected On-Site** **Warning**
- 08A-04-5:High Priority - Raw animal food stored over or with unwashed produce. Observed raw pork stored over limes in the walk in cooler. Operator moved the pork. **Corrected On-Site** **Warning**
- 35A-04-4:High Priority - Rodent activity present as evidenced by rodent droppings found. Observed approximately 15 rodent droppings under their triple sink in the kitchen. Observed approximately 2 rodent droppings on the floor of the cook line. Observed approximately 6 rodent droppings on the floor of the back dry storage area. Observed approximately 2 rodent droppings on the floor Operator started to sweep and mop the areas, and operator at this time has contacted pest control. **Corrective Action Taken** **Warning**
- 41-10-4:High Priority - Toxic substance/chemical improperly stored. Observed a canister of rat repellent stored next to clean dishes on the cook line. Operator removed the canister. **Corrected On-Site** **Warning**
- 31A-11-4:Intermediate - Handwash sink used for purposes other than handwashing. Observed them use their hand wash sink to defrost shrimp. Operator removed the shrimp. **Corrected On-Site** **Warning**
Food safety inspection conducted on 2/25/2025 revealed 9 total violations (4 high priority, 1 intermediate, 4 basic).
